Cost of Living Comparison Between Lisbon and ElistaCost of Living Comparison Between Lisbon and Elista
Monthly Cost of Living
😐A single person spends $2,280 per month in Lisbon vs $943 in Elista, rent included.
😐A couple spends around $3,294 per month in Lisbon vs $1,460 in Elista, rent included.
😐A family of three spends $4,307 per month in Lisbon vs $1,976 in Elista, rent included.
😐Lisbon costs about 142% more than Elista, driven mainly by Eating Out.
📊Lisbon sits 71% above the global median, while Elista is 29% below – they fall on opposite sides of the world average.

Cost Breakdown
🏠A central one-bedroom costs $1,612 in Lisbon versus $451 in Elista.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.
💰Salaries run about 315% higher in Lisbon,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.
🛒A mid-range dinner for two costs $63.0 in Lisbon versus $38.00 in Elista.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$267 vs $188 – making Elista the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
